Unleashing the Power of Metal
Metal is Apple's graphics technology that allows developers to leverage the full potential of the GPU (Graphics Processing Unit) on Mac systems. It provides direct access to the graphics hardware, enabling superior performance and efficiency in rendering graphics-intensive applications. Metal allows developers to take advantage of parallel processing, efficient memory management, and reduced overhead, resulting in faster rendering and improved visual quality.
By using a Metal capable graphics card, Mac Pro users can fully utilize the benefits of Metal technology. The compatibility and optimization between Metal and the graphics card ensure that demanding tasks such as rendering high-resolution 3D models, working with large datasets, and running graphics-intensive applications can be handled efficiently, leading to enhanced productivity and smoother user experience.
Furthermore, Metal brings additional features like tessellation, which allows for more detailed and realistic geometry in 3D graphics, and GPU-driven compute processing, which accelerates tasks that require heavy computational power, such as machine learning and scientific simulations. With a Metal capable graphics card, Mac Pro users can tap into these advanced features and push the boundaries of what their workstation can achieve.
Choosing the Right Metal Capable Graphics Card
When it comes to selecting a Metal capable graphics card for your Mac Pro, there are a few factors to consider. First and foremost, you need to ensure compatibility with your Mac Pro model and operating system. Apple provides a list of supported graphics cards for Metal on their website, so it is essential to check that the card you choose is officially supported.
The performance specifications of the graphics card are also crucial. Look for cards with a high number of CUDA cores or stream processors, as they determine the processing power of the GPU. Higher memory bandwidth and VRAM capacity are also beneficial for handling complex graphics tasks and working with large datasets.
Another consideration is the power requirements and physical size of the graphics card. Ensure that your Mac Pro's power supply can handle the additional load, and the card can fit into the available slot in your workstation. Additionally, if you plan to connect multiple displays, make sure the graphics card supports the required number of display outputs.
Lastly, consider the brand and reputation of the graphics card manufacturer. Opting for well-established brands with reliable customer support can ensure a smoother experience in case of any technical issues or driver updates. Reading reviews and benchmarks can also help you make an informed decision.
Installation and Optimization
Installing a Metal capable graphics card in your Mac Pro involves a few steps. First, you need to power off your Mac Pro and disconnect all cables. Open the side panel of your workstation to access the PCIe slots. Carefully insert the graphics card into an available slot, ensuring it is seated correctly and securely. Then, close the side panel, reconnect all cables, and power on your Mac Pro.
After installing the card, it is crucial to install the latest drivers provided by the graphics card manufacturer. These drivers enable optimal performance and compatibility with Metal technology. You can usually download the drivers from the manufacturer's website and follow the installation instructions provided.
Once the new graphics card is installed and the drivers are updated, it is recommended to test its performance using benchmarking tools or graphics-intensive applications. This allows you to verify that the card is functioning correctly and experiencing the expected improvements in performance.
